370 cu. in., stock 6.0 gaskets, stock ls6 heads, f13 112 cam, ls6 intake and all the other mods in sig, im hoping for 420 or so..
oh and scr is about 11.1 and dcr 8.3ish-8.4

Similar to mine
370 cid, 6.0 MLS, PRC stage 2.5/5.3L heads milled .025 {58.83 cc} (2.04int/1.575exh), 232/234 Comp cam on a 113+0, ~11.7 SCR and 8.6x DCR
